University of Iowa Campus Safety is seeking a Dispatcher I. Under general supervision, the person in this role provides communications and coordination of a public safety nature for university Campus Safety, other departments, and also for surrounding public safety agencies by utilizing multi-frequency radio, computer networks, telephone, and personal contact. This position is responsible for monitoring university emergency phones and various alarm systems.
Duties- Operates a multi-frequency radio system per FCC requirements; ability to multi-task and document, recall, and relay information accurately.
- Assigns duty personnel to requests for assistance/service in conjunction with shift commander. Maintains location and status of personnel, as applicable.
- Operates a multi-line telephone system for emergency and business operations. Operates NCIC/IOWA Systems.
- Monitors, updates, and relays information regarding fire and burglar alarms from systems located in the emergency communications center.
